Preparing for the North Carolina Research Campus
The North Carolina Research Campus is a unique project that includes the participation of major research universities and enormous investments by a single individual in state-of-the-art research facilities and equipment.
These are just some of the aspects that make the project an incredible opportunity for the Kannapolis area and the region, and create the potential for significant impacts to the local, regional, and state economy.
The City of Kannapolis retained Market Street Services, an economic and community development consulting firm based in Atlanta, Georgia, to conduct an economic impact analysis and SWOT (strengths, weaknesses, opportunities, and threats) analysis of the North Carolina Research Campus.
A few key points related to the SWOT Analysis and Impact Assessment:
- In order for the impact assessment to come to fruition, the SWOT recommendations must be fully implemented by the community and, in some cases, the region.
- The report confirms that the NCRC has the potential to be a major economic engine for our region, and provides a map for the city to follow to ensure that this happens.
- Various business and rating publications rank the three comparison communities very highly, including the annual “best place to live,” ranking by Money Magazine.
- This report is a reflection of our transition form textiles to biotech. While we have made great progress in many areas, it shows that we still have work to do to fully capitalize on the opportunity the NCRC brings to the region.
- Conducting the study was a critical step in validating what’s possible with the Research Campus, providing frank insight on how we compare with our competitor cities, and helping us determine what investments we need to make in the future.
- The report finds that we are quite strong in transportation, regional support for entrepreneurship, and state support for biotechnology. We have more work to do in terms of improving K-12 performance and higher education opportunities, and embracing diversity.
